Abstract

The invention relates to a toroidal-core (annular-core) current transformer for mounting in an earthed metal enclosure which surrounds a high-voltage conductor, having at least one toroidal core which has a winding using the feed wires passing through the metal enclosure and a metal shielding which surrounds the winding. In order to prevent interference voltages in the measurement signal, the metal shielding is designed with low resistance and low inductance. The metal shielding is formed by a conducting layer, in particular foil or fabric which has an insulating gap in order to prevent short-circuit winding. A shielding in the form of a strip winding changes the winding direction after each turn. <IMAGE>
